TCSports1 Posted November 4, 2023 Report Share Posted November 4, 2023 I was very impressed by Smith County. Martin throws a great long ball, they have speedy receivers and their ground game is very solid. Line is big and physical. Defense is stifling. Fayetteville has athletes but Forrest scored at will against them. I think Willoughby has to be exceptional for Fayetteville to win.Hughes is really good but I don’t see him doing the kind of damage on the ground against Smith as he did against Forrest. Just don’t think Fayetteville can hold up defensively. At first guess I’d say Smith by at least two scores. Quote Link to comment Share on other sites More sharing options...
